Attendees reviewed the proposal to outsource tier-one customer support to Brightquay Services, based in Ostenvale. Ms. Harrow presented cost modelling showing a projected 18% reduction in handling costs, contingent on a six-month transition. Concerns were raised by Mr. Delvin regarding quality metrics and escalation paths; these will be documented before contract drafting. The incoming director should review the risk register prior to sign-off. The following note is appended for the incoming director's eyes only.

management briefing: Project Ulavan slips by two quarters because of the staffing delay.

**Mgmt Meeting Minutes — Retiring the Brightline Range**

Quick recap for sales leads at Fenholt Supplies: we agreed to retire the Brightline fixture range by year-end. Remaining stock moves to clearance pricing next month, and accounts on standing orders get migrated to the Lumetta range. Trade-in incentives were approved in principle. The confidential note on next steps sits just below.

board note of bajof-bajeg: The pricing group signed off on a budget of $13.4 million for Project Sildor. The renewal with Lamixek Holdings closes at $48.9 million a year, 49 percent above the last contract.

Finance Review Summary — Customer Concentration, Verelux Group

Revenue concentration remains elevated: the Dunmoor account represents 31% of recurring income, up from 26% last year. Two further accounts together add 18%. Contract renewal timing clusters in the second quarter, compounding exposure. Heads of department should factor this into hiring and inventory commitments. Mitigation options are under review, and the confidential note below sets out the plan.

internal memo for faweg-hahip: Silokix Works plans to lower the Tamvan list price by 8 percent in June.